Gemini Drops represent Google's innovative new monthly initiative designed to empower users to fully leverage the capabilities of the Gemini app. Defined as a regular update mechanism, these drops aim to provide comprehensive insights and guidance on how individuals can extract maximum value and efficiency from their interactions with the artificial intelligence platform. The core purpose is to ensure that users remain consistently informed about the evolving features, improvements, and optimal usage strategies for the Gemini application, effectively bridging the gap between new developments and user adoption.
